32 ;; -------------------------------------------------------------------------
33 ;; Latencies
34 ;; Latest latency figures (all in FCB cycles). PowerPC to FPU frequency ratio
35 ;; assumed to be 1/2. (most common deployment)
36 ;; Add 2 PPC cycles for (register file access + wb) and 2 PPC cycles
37 ;; for issue (from PPC)
38 ;; SP DP
39 ;; Loads: 4 6
40 ;; Stores: 1 2 (from availability of data)
41 ;; Move/Abs/Neg: 1 1
42 ;; Add/Subtract: 5 7
43 ;; Multiply: 4 11
44 ;; Multiply-add: 10 19
45 ;; Convert (any): 4 6
46 ;; Divide/Sqrt: 27 56
47 ;; Compares: 1 2
48 ;;
49 ;; bypasses needed for forwarding capability of the FPU.
50 ;; Add this at some future time.
51 ;; -------------------------------------------------------------------------
